Abstract
Systems, methods, and computer program products to perform an operation comprising receiving, by a mobile device, an indication to output a notification, determining an orientation of the mobile device, determining a location of a wearable device relative to the mobile device, and selecting, based on the determined orientation of the mobile device and the location of the wearable device relative to the mobile device, at least one of the mobile device and the wearable device to output the notification.
